no way to compare when less than two revisions

Différences

Ci-dessous, les différences entre deux révisions de la page.


Prochaine révision
pratique:informatique:php [08/10/2015 12:19] – créée Zatalyz
Ligne 1: Ligne 1:
 +====== PHP ======
 +Je me lance dans l'apprentissage de php, via [[https://openclassrooms.com/courses/concevez-votre-site-web-avec-php-et-mysql|le cours d'Openclassrooms]]. Cette page sert d'aide-mémoire sur le langage.
  
 +===== Bases =====
 +Insérer un bout de code php dans du html :
 +<code php>
 +<?php 
 +?>
 +</code>
 +
 +  * Toujours mettre un '';'' à la fin d'une instruction.
 +  * Commentaires sur une ligne : ''<nowiki>//</nowiki>''
 +  * Commentaires sur plusieurs lignes, encadrés par ''<nowiki>/*</nowiki>'' et ''<nowiki>*/</nowiki>''.
 +
 +===== Fonctions =====
 +  * ''echo'' pour afficher du texte ou le résultat de [[#variables|variables]]. Ex : <code php><?php echo "bla"; ?></code>
 +  * ''include()'' pour inclure une autre page. Ex : <code php><?php include("bla.php"); ?></code>
 +
 +===== Variables =====
 +
 +==== Type de données ====
 +^ Type de donnée ^ Exemple ^
 +| string | "Du texte" |
 +| int | 42 |
 +| float | 14.7 |
 +| bool | true/false |
 +| NULL | (rien) |
 +
 +==== Écrire une variable ====
 +Exemple :
 +<code php><?php
 +$age_du_capitaine = 17;
 +?></code>
 +Ne pas oublier : ''$'' ''='' '';''
 +
 +===== Conditions =====
 +^ Symbole ^ Signification ^
 +| == | Est égal à |
 +| > | Est supérieur à |
 +| < | Est inférieur à |
 +| >= | Est supérieur ou égal à |
 +| <= | Est inférieur ou égal à |
 +| != | Est différent de |
 +
 +''if'' ''(condition/variable)'' ''{}'' //facultatif// ''else'' '{}''
 +
 +Exemple
 +<code php>
 +<?php
 +$age = 8;
 +
 +if ($age <= 12)
 +{
 +    echo "Salut gamin !";
 +}
 +else
 +{
 +    echo "Salut vieux !";
 +}
 +?></code>
CC Attribution-Noncommercial-Share Alike 4.0 International Driven by DokuWiki
pratique/informatique/php.txt · Dernière modification : 30/11/2020 10:36 de 127.0.0.1